"Energy efficient", "Economical in maintenance" -
are really up-to-date issues. Lighting a building, illuminating an
advertising gantry or installing a neon sign over the entrance, we pay
attention to the power consumption, because we know that these devices
are "silent power consumers". A device, working 24 hours a day, must be
energy efficient. Each 1W of power consumption costs 4.40 PLN per year.
100W a year amounts to 440 PLN. Here is the calculating method:
1W
= 0.001kW
0.001kW x 24h x 365 = 8.76 kWh (kilowatt-hours)
8.76
x 0,50 PLN = 4.40 PLN
